Ohio on the Global Stage: Leading the Way in U.S. Exports

More than 95 percent of the world’s population and two-thirds of global purchasing power are located outside America’s borders. However, less than 1 percent of the 30 million businesses in the U.S. engage in exporting. While small and medium-sized companies make up nearly 97 percent of U.S. exporters, they contribute to only about 20 percent of the total export value of U.S. goods.

Exporting enables companies to diversify their portfolios and withstand fluctuations in the domestic economy. Moreover, for every $1 billion in U.S. exports, approximately 5,279 jobs are created or supported in the manufacturing sector (Source: U.S. Commercial Service).

Ohio ranks as the ninth-largest exporting state in the U.S. and consistently is among the top 10 exporting states nationwide. The leading export industries in Ohio include machinery, vehicles, aircraft, electrical machinery, plastics, and oilseeds. The Department of Development offers several programs designed to assist small businesses in starting or expanding their global trade efforts.

International Market Access Grant for Exporters (IMAGE):

Financial assistance for exporters

Ohio Export Internship Program:

Hire specially trained export interns 

International Market Support:

International business-to-business matchmaking

Ohio Export Assistance Statewide Network:

Export counseling and education

Appalachian Export Development Program (AEDP):

Reimbursement-based grant for businesses with two years or less of international sales.
